Bringing Back the Chill: A Long-Overdue Aircond Restoration
Can you believe it? Since 2007, the cooling coil in this Proton Saga has never been serviced. After nearly two decades, the air conditioning was struggling to stay cold in heavy traffic, and a persistent bad smell was making every drive uncomfortable. It was finally time for a total system “refresh.”
In this video, I take you through the entire restoration process:
- The Deep Clean: Removing the original cooling coil and blower for a thorough wash (no spray cleaners here—we did it the right way!).
- The Upgrades: Why I decided to replace the front condenser and swap the old, vibrating compressor for a reconditioned unit.
- The Results: Testing the system under the 4:00 PM Malaysian sun. Is the fan speed at “1” really enough to keep it freezing now?
- Maintenance Tips: Why I used stickers to seal off the “outside air” intake to prevent leaves from clogging the new system.
- The Verdict: My honest thoughts on using a reconditioned compressor and what I’ll be monitoring over the next 6 to 12 months.
